Definition
An approach to researching a topic by querying multiple AI models and forums, rather than relying on a single source. This ensures a broader and potentially more accurate understanding.
Why it matters (in Poovi’s context)
Highlights the need for diverse AI inputs for robust research, acknowledging that different models may offer unique perspectives or information.
Key properties or components
- Querying multiple LLMs (GPT, Grock, Plexity)
- Consulting various forums
- Aim: Comprehensive understanding
